On June 9th, 2010, Intersolar Europe presented the Intersolar AWARD International Technology Prize to nine companies judged to provide the top technological innovations in the solar industry. Three entries were selected by juries in each of three categories: Photovoltaics (PV), solar thermal, and, for the first time this year, PV production technology. This is the third year that Intersolar has presented these awards, and for the first time the competition was open to exhibitors at Intersolar North America as well.

"Intersolar Europe is the world's largest exhibition for the solar industry and the most influential forum for innovative technologies and services in the fields of photovoltaics and solar thermal technology", read a statement by Intersolar Europe. "It therefore serves as a gauge of innovative power within the solar industry. In awarding the prize, organizers Solar Promotion GmbH and Freiburg Wirtschaft Touristik und Messe GmbH & Co. KG (FWTM), in cooperation with the German Solar Industry Association (BSW-Solar), wish to create an incentive for companies to play an active role in shaping the future of sustainable energy supply."

Intersolar says the competition had 2,300 entries this year. The competition was juried by three independent juries, whose members were made up of experts from research, science, industry and trade media. The winning companies and the product that represented the winning entry are listed below.
